Yamaha RBX270J

Yamaha RBX270J

Electric Basses
Color/Finish: Black Year: 1990s

In this Youtube video of Jimmy Eat World performing in late 1996 around the 3:05 mark, Rick Burch can be spotted with what looks to be a Yamaha bass guitar. He used this bass with Jimmy Eat World from around 1995-1997 and possibly recorded Static Prevails and other J.E.W material from this time period. It is difficult to tell due to there being little footage of the band from this period, and by early 1997 Burch would start using a Musicman Stingray Bass.

In this video of a live performance of Jimmy Eat World from March 1997, Rick Burch can be seen using a MusicMan Stingray bass guitar, he may have possibly also used this on the Jimmy Eat World/Jejune split single released in 1997. And by mid-late 1997 he would switch to Fender Precision basses.
